Internal memo — to the receiving site at Hallowmere. The notarised deed for the Corvane Mill parcel has been executed and stamped by the notary's office in Aldenreach. It travels as a single sealed folder; no copies accompany it, and none should be made on arrival. Please have someone from your admin desk available during the delivery window on Thursday morning and confirm receipt in the property register the same day. The confidential courier hand-over instruction is set out directly below.

courier memo of yawep-yafog: the pramir ulaix courier leaves the ulavan aldix frair zorok oliiel joreth rusdor fenvan ledger at gate 1305 under passcode 514738

## Step 4: Enable Offline Mode

After installing the Fieldhawk client, switch the survey sync layer to offline-first. This lets crews in low-coverage areas queue entries locally until a connection returns. The queue flushes automatically once the device reconnects, so no manual export is needed. Apply the settings below to every tablet before it leaves the depot.

service settings:
PRAWYN_PIN=9848
PRAWYN_METRICS_HOST=metrics.prawyn.lumicworks.corp
PRAWYN_LOG_LEVEL=warn
PRAWYN_TENANT=pelius

**Temporary Site: Harlow Annexe**

While the main Fennimore Building is under renovation, all contractor inductions take place at the Harlow Annexe on Draycott Lane. Sign in at the portacabin marked Unit 2 and collect your high-vis vest from the rack. The annexe side door stays locked at all times; enter using the code below.

turnstile pass: bdg-SRTCPM-91257825

## Further reading

The Tollgrim billing worker uses a blue-green deploy: two identical worker pools, one live, one idle, with traffic flipped via the queue router. It's simple but the cutover has sharp edges — in-flight invoices must drain before the flip, or you double-charge. Before your first deploy, read the step-by-step cutover guide on our internal deploy page.

dashboard of bafof-hafog = https://confluence.lumiclabs.internal/display/browse/display/6a09a20a